The role of National Human Rights Institution (NHRI) or Commission in preventing torture and other forms of ill treatment. The main role of NHRI is promoting ratification and implementation of international law in Malaysia. Raising public awareness, public education which can build greater knowledge and understanding.

Recommendations The NHRIs should have guidelines to be followed by the States in event of torture. The example can be drawn from the Indian NHRC which has guidelines on custodial deaths etc. calling for videography of postmortem and submitting it to NHRC within 48 hours. The NHRIs should communicate through website and reports about actions taken on torture cases. Most of the times despite having good practices and guidelines, civil society is unaware about action taken or not taken by the commission. It has escalated in the absence of annual reports for almost half a decade for many NHRIs.

The NHRIs should initiate a UN CAT campaigns The NHRIs should initiate a UN CAT campaigns. There have been many campaigns by the civil society. NHRC more often has been seen distanced away from campaigns and calls to end torture. NHRIs should recognise torture and initiate campaigns and public education on issue of torture. SUHAKAM’s UN CAT. With regard to torture and HRDs, HRDs face torture not from the point of arrest or abduction but also by threats and intimations. NHRIs need to strengthen the HRD efforts and establish structures which HRDs can approach in distress and risk. The status of focal points on HRDs in each NHRI should be that of a commissioner so that the focal point have powers to immediately intervene.

It has been increasingly seen the use of violence on peaceful assemblies in the recent years. NHRIs need to intervene immediately to ensure the right to peaceful assembly and associations. NHRIs need to be present, probably through observers, during peaceful assemblies, to ensure that no violence by the State forces is initiated. Hotline, Observers, Negotiator, Visit Police Stations. In many countries in Asia, CSOs are threatened and harassed by the State often leading to canceling of their registration and freedom to associate and operate. NHRIs need to intervene through cases, statements, studying of such related laws etc. to ensure right to freedom of association continues in democratic spaces.

NHRIs should ask the respective governments to ratify UN CAT NHRIs should ask the respective governments to ratify UN CAT. Many countries in Asia still haven't ratified CAT. For those who have, NHRIs should ask the respective governments to ratify OP CAT. Advising on the content of draft of anti-torture laws and Legislative review/legal reforms to criminalize act of torture Continue to visit prison (surprise visits) Finally, with regard to torture and killings by military/army, many of the NHRIs have claimed that its out of their jurisdiction. However what can not be denied is gross violation of human rights by the armed forces. NHRIs should atleast intervene in the proceedings through independent investigations and submitting the same to the court of law.
